pdnDot1dBasePortRole OBJECT-TYPE
|
||||
SYNTAX INTEGER {
|
||||
subscriber (1),
|
||||
network (2)
|
||||
}
|
||||
MAX-ACCESS read-write
|
||||
STATUS current
|
||||
DESCRIPTION "This object defines the role of a bridge port.
|
||||
|
||||
The role on a bridge port role can be defined as
|
||||
subscriber or network as follows:
|
||||
|
||||
Subscriber:
|
||||
----------
|
||||
A port on the IP DSLAM or Aggregator that faces toward
|
||||
or directly connects to a DSL interface on which an end
|
||||
user (subscriber) would be located.
|
||||
|
||||
This would typically be the DSL ports directly on a unit
|
||||
or the ports on an aggregator that connect to another DSLAM.
|
||||
|
||||
Network:
|
||||
-------
|
||||
A Port that connects to the service providers network,
|
||||
aggregation device or to a shared resource such as a server.
|
||||
"
|
||||
::= { pdnDot1dBasePortExtEntry 2 }

pdnDot1dBasePortUnknownMulticastForwardingMode OBJECT-TYPE
|
||||
SYNTAX INTEGER {
|
||||
flood (1),
|
||||
drop (2)
|
||||
}
|
||||
MAX-ACCESS read-write
|
||||
STATUS current
|
||||
DESCRIPTION "Configures the layer 2 unknown multicast forwarding
|
||||
mode. A layer 2 frame is `unknown' if there is no
|
||||
entry in the Forwarding Database which identifies
|
||||
the set of ports to forward the multicast frame on.
|
||||
When set to `flood(1)', the `unknown' multicast frame
|
||||
will be forwarded on all bridge ports. When set to
|
||||
`drop(2)', the `unknown' multicast frame will be
|
||||
dropped and not be forwarded on any bridge port."
|
||||
::= { pdnDot1dBasePortExtEntry 3 }

pdnDot1dTrafficProfileNextIndex OBJECT-TYPE
|
||||
SYNTAX TestAndIncr
|
||||
MAX-ACCESS read-write
|
||||
STATUS current
|
||||
DESCRIPTION "This object is used to establish the next unused
|
||||
index (pdnDot1dTrafficProfileIndex) for the
|
||||
pdnDot1dTrafficProfileTable.
|
||||
|
||||
This object is used to assist the manager in
|
||||
selecting a value for pdnDot1dTrafficProfileIndex.
|
||||
Because this object is of syntax TestAndIncr (see the
|
||||
SNMPv2-TC document, RFC 2579), it can also be used
|
||||
to avoid race conditions with multiple managers
|
||||
trying to create rows in the table.
|
||||
|
||||
If the result of the SET for
|
||||
pdnDot1dTrafficProfileIndex is not success, this means
|
||||
the value has been changed from index (i.e. another
|
||||
manager used the value), so a new value is required.
|
||||
|
||||
The algorithm is:
|
||||
done = false
|
||||
while done == false
|
||||
index = GET (pdnDot1dTrafficProfileNextIndex.0)
|
||||
SET (pdnDot1dTrafficProfileNextIndex.0=index)
|
||||
if (set failed)
|
||||
done = false
|
||||
else
|
||||
pdnDot1dTrafficProfileRowStatus.index=createAndGo
|
||||
SET (pdnDot1dTrafficProfileRowStatus.index)
|
||||
if (set failed)
|
||||
done = false
|
||||
else
|
||||
done = true
|
||||
other error handling
|
||||
|
||||
This description was modeled from RFC2494,
|
||||
DS0BUNDLE-MIB."
|
||||
::= { pdnDot1dTrafficProfile 1 }
